USC and Wisconsin Share Big Ten Volleyball Weekly Honors
Badgers’ Colyer, Booth and Fuerbringer and Trojans’ Messer earn weekly awards
Player of the Week
Mimi Colyer, Wisconsin
Sr. – OH – Lincoln, Calif.
•
• Helped the Badgers to another 2-0 week after wins over No. 15 Florida (3-1) and Marquette (3-0)
•
• Reached double figures in kills in both matches, including a season-high 27 against the nationally ranked Gators. Added 14 digs in the effort for her second double-double of the season and 38th of her career
•
• Finished the week with 40 kills while hitting .390 (40-8-82), tallying 13 kills with a .550 hitting percentage vs. Marquette
•
• Averaged 5.71 kills per set, 2.86 digs per set and 6.50 points per set over the two matches
•
• Last Wisconsin Player of the Week: Mimi Colyer (Sept. 15, 2024)
Defensive Player of the Week
Carter Booth, Wisconsin
Sr. – MB – Denver, Colo.
•
• Led the Badger defense as part of a 2-0 week totaling 12.0 blocks in seven sets, including a season-high nine blocks against No. 15 Florida
•
• Averaged 1.71 blocks per set while adding 1.57 kills per set and 2.50 points per set
•
• Last Wisconsin Defensive Player of the Week: Carter Booth (Oct. 21, 2024)
Setter of the Week
Charlie Fuerbringer, Wisconsin
So. – S – Hermosa Beach, Calif.
•
• Led the Badgers to a 2-0 weekend, including a sweep at Marquette and a 3-1 win against No. 15 Florida
•
• In seven sets, Fuerbringer averaged 11.71 assists per set, 2.14 digs per set and added 0.86 kills and blocks per set
•
• Against the nationally ranked Gators, Fuerbringer dished out a season-best 50 assists and recorded her fourth double-double of the season adding 15 digs. Fuerbringer set the Badgers to a .265 hitting percentage
•
• Tallied 32 assists in three sets against Marquette, leading Wisconsin to a .487 hitting percentage, the fourth time this season that Wisconsin has hit above .440 in a match
•
• Earns second consecutive Setter of the Week honor
•
• Last Wisconsin Setter of the Week: Charlie Fuerbringer (Sept. 15, 2025)
Freshman of the Week
Reese Messer, USC
S – Olathe, Kan.
•
• Led USC to three wins to extend to a four-match win streak and finish non-conference play 9-1
•
• Averaged 11.36 assists per set and 2.64 digs per set in 11 sets of action across the three wins against LSU (twice) and California
•
• Produced her third and fourth double-doubles with 40 assists and 10 digs against LSU and 43 assists and a career-high 12 digs against Cal
•
• Reached a career-best five blocks against Cal with three solo blocks
•
• Last USC Freshman of the Week: Jadyn Livings (Sept. 23, 2024)
